Where is the geographical location of Jungfrau?

The geographical location of Jungfrau is 18km southeast of Interlaken tourist destination.

Jungfrau is a famous mountain peak in the Alps in Berne Highland, Switzerland, with an altitude of 4,158 meters. Overlooking Laut Brennen Valley, it is located 18km southeast of Interlaken tourist destination.

This scenic mountain separates Bourne from Valais, which is a part of Bourne Alps. As one of the classic tourist attractions in Italy and Switzerland, Jungfrau has been attracting tourists from all directions with snow and peaks, sunshine and clouds.

Tickets and opening hours of Jungfrau:

1. Tickets for Jungfrau:

Jungfrau itself does not need tickets, but needs to buy train tickets to Jungfrau, and the possibility of hiking up the mountain is very small. The round-trip train ticket is 197.6 Swiss francs for adults, 98.8 Swiss francs for children aged 6-16, and 148.4 Swiss francs for passengers with Eurail passes. The above prices include the return trip.

2. Opening hours of Jungfrau:

Jungfrau is often closed due to the weather, and it is generally not known whether it is open until the morning.
